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5114 907000341 9992137 3421
586787 464 33707490345
586787 464 33707490345
24 630273167 57
All about undefined
Interested in learning more?
586787 464 33707490345
24 630273167 57
See more
36287 1063753498
80 67436724684 261215807
See more
38187993 88
4436780 7410034 5733155 989
See more